Mar 12, 2021 · When looking at ice axe length you want it to be no longer than ankle length when holding it at your side - it's not a walking stick. Ice axe buyer’s guide. Mine is about an inch above my ankle which I find to be just about perfect. Its design makes it one of the lightest and most efficient ice tools on the market. For ski touring I would go a little shorter (round about 50cm) and lightweight.
